Constantes LINEMEDIAMODE_
As constantes LINEMEDIAMODE_ descrevem tipos de mídia (ou modos)de uma sessão ou chamada de comunicação.
-
LINEMEDIAMODE_AUTOMATEDVOICE
-
-
A energia de voz foi detectada na chamada e a voz é tratada localmente por um aplicativo automatizado, como com um aplicativo de computador de resposta. Quando um provedor de serviços não consegue distinguir entre voz interativa e automatizada em uma chamada de entrada, ele relatará a chamada como voz interativa.
-
-
LINEMEDIAMODE_DATAMODEM
-
-
Uma sessão de modem de dados na chamada. Os protocolos de modem atuais exigem que a estação chamada inicie o handshake. Para uma chamada de modem de dados de entrada, o aplicativo normalmente não pode fazer nenhuma detecção positiva. Como o provedor de serviços faz essa determinação é sua escolha. Por exemplo, um período de silêncio logo após atender a uma chamada de entrada pode ser usado como uma heurística para decidir que essa pode ser uma chamada de modem de dados.
-
-
LINEMEDIAMODE_ADSI
-
-
Uma sessão ADSI (Interface de Serviços de Exibição Analógico) na chamada. O ADSI aprimora as chamadas de voz com informações alfanuméricas baixadas para o telefone e o uso de botões macios no telefone.
-
-
LINEMEDIAMODE_DIGITALDATA
-
-
Um fluxo de dados digital de formato não especificado.
-
-
LINEMEDIAMODE_G3FAX
-
-
Um fax do grupo 3 está sendo enviado ou recebido pela chamada.
-
-
LINEMEDIAMODE_G4FAX
-
-
Um fax do grupo 4 está sendo enviado ou recebido pela chamada.
-
-
LINEMEDIAMODE_INTERACTIVEVOICE
-
-
A energia de voz foi detectada na chamada, e a chamada é tratada como uma chamada de voz interativa com humanos em ambas as extremidades.
-
-
LINEMEDIAMODE_MIXED
-
-
Uma sessão mista na chamada. Mixed é um dos serviços telemáticos do ISDN.
-
-
LINEMEDIAMODE_TDD
-
-
Uma sessão TDD (Dispositivos de Telefonia para Surdos) na chamada.
-
-
LINEMEDIAMODE_TELETEX
-
-
Uma sessão de teletex na chamada. O teletex é um dos serviços telemáticos.
-
-
LINEMEDIAMODE_TELEX
-
-
Uma sessão telex na chamada. O Telex é um dos serviços telemáticos.
-
-
LINEMEDIAMODE_VIDEO
-
-
O tipo de mídia da chamada é vídeo. (TAPI versões 2.1 e posteriores)
-
-
LINEMEDIAMODE_VIDEOTEX
-
-
Uma sessão de videotex na chamada. O Videotex é um dos serviços telemáticos.
-
-
LINEMEDIAMODE_VOICEVIEW
-
-
O tipo de mídia da chamada é VoiceView. (TAPI versões 1.4 e posteriores)
-
-
LINEMEDIAMODE_UNKNOWN
-
-
Existe um fluxo de mídia, mas seu modo não é conhecido no momento e pode se tornar conhecido posteriormente. Isso corresponderia a uma chamada com um tipo de mídia não classificado. Em ambientes típicos de telefonia analógica, o tipo de mídia de uma chamada de entrada pode ser desconhecido até que a chamada tenha sido atendida e o fluxo de mídia tenha sido filtrado para fazer uma determinação.
Se o sinalizador de modo de mídia desconhecido estiver definido, outros sinalizadores de mídia também poderão ser definidos. Isso é usado para significar que a mídia é desconhecida, mas que é provável que seja um dos outros tipos de mídia selecionados.
-
Comentários
Todos os 32 bits são reservados.
Observe que o modo de portador e o tipo de mídia são noções diferentes. O modo de portador de uma chamada é uma indicação da qualidade da conexão telefônica, conforme fornecido principalmente pela rede. O tipo de mídia de uma chamada é uma indicação do tipo de fluxo de informações que é trocado por essa chamada. O modem de dados ou fax do grupo 3 são tipos de mídia que usam uma chamada com um modo de portador de voz de 3,1 kHz.
Para compatibilidade com versões anteriores, é responsabilidade do provedor de serviços examinar a versão da API negociada na linha e não usar esse valor LINEMEDIAMODE_ se não houver suporte na versão negociada.
Requisitos
Requisito | Valor |
---|---|
Versão do TAPI |
Requer TAPI 2.0 ou posterior |
Cabeçalho |
|